diff --git a/app/src/main/java/net/foucry/pilldroid/CustomScannerActivity.java b/app/src/main/java/net/foucry/pilldroid/CustomScannerActivity.java index fec670d..8938e9e 100644 --- a/app/src/main/java/net/foucry/pilldroid/CustomScannerActivity.java +++ b/app/src/main/java/net/foucry/pilldroid/CustomScannerActivity.java @@ -93,7 +93,7 @@ public class CustomScannerActivity extends AppCompatActivity implements Decorate } @Override - protected void onSaveInstanceState(Bundle outState) { + protected void onSaveInstanceState(@NonNull Bundle outState) { super.onSaveInstanceState(outState); capture.onSaveInstanceState(outState); } @@ -140,6 +140,7 @@ public class CustomScannerActivity extends AppCompatActivity implements Decorate @Override public void onRequestPermissionsResult(int requestCode, @NonNull String[] permissions, @NonNull int[] grantResults) { + super.onRequestPermissionsResult(requestCode, permissions, grantResults); capture.onRequestPermissionsResult(requestCode, permissions, grantResults); } diff --git a/app/src/main/java/net/foucry/pilldroid/DrugListActivity.java b/app/src/main/java/net/foucry/pilldroid/DrugListActivity.java index 930a236..ff89bc9 100644 --- a/app/src/main/java/net/foucry/pilldroid/DrugListActivity.java +++ b/app/src/main/java/net/foucry/pilldroid/DrugListActivity.java @@ -794,9 +794,13 @@ public class DrugListActivity extends AppCompatActivity { // }); Button btn_export = findViewById(R.id.switch_btn_export); + assert btn_export != null; Button btn_import = findViewById(R.id.switch_btn_import); + assert btn_import != null; Button btn_properties = findViewById(R.id.btn_properties); + assert btn_properties != null; Button btn_backupLocation = findViewById(R.id.btn_backup_location); + assert btn_backupLocation != null; encryptBackup = sharedPreferences.getBoolean(spEncryptBackup, true); storageLocation = sharedPreferences.getInt(spStorageLocation, 1); @@ -868,7 +872,7 @@ public class DrugListActivity extends AppCompatActivity { Log.i(TAG, "ok button"); - PrescriptionDatabase prescriptions = PrescriptionDatabase.getInstanceDatabase(this); + PrescriptionDatabase.getInstanceDatabase(this); final RoomBackup roomBackup = new RoomBackup(DrugListActivity.this); if (btn_export.isEnabled()) { btn_export.setOnClickListener(v -> {